Car accident claims have strict deadlines

No two car accidents are alike. From minor fender benders to multi-car pileups, absolutely anything can happen out on the open road. It’s easy to sustain serious injuries in car accidents, which means you could need immediate medical treatment.

Sometimes injuries can be long-lasting and cause life-altering problems for Hoosiers and their families. These types of injuries cause people to pursue personal injury claims so they can recover damages that the other party responsible for the crash caused.

Many Hoosiers make the mistake of believing they have unlimited time to file a claim after getting involved in a car accident. Sadly, this just is not true. There are strict limits in place dictating exactly how long you have to file a claim after your accident. This time period is known as the statute of limitations.

The statute of limitations for filing personal injury claims for most car accidents in Indiana is two years. The time frame begins with the day of the accident. In other words, once the accident starts, the clock has already started ticking.

If you choose not to take action during this two-year time period, you will not be able to pursue a personal injury claim against the other party involved in the accident. Even if the other party was very clearly responsible for your injuries and you were blameless, you cannot pursue a personal injury claim if the statute of limitations has expired.

This is generally the rule; however, some exceptions do exist.

Some exemptions to the rule include:

· If a person involved in the accident dies from their injuries within the initial two-year window, their loved ones may pursue a wrongful death claim up to 18 months (about 1 and a half years) after the person’s death

· If a minor has been injured in an accident, they have two years to file a claim starting on their 18th birthday
